Why Live in North Fork

North Fork in Decatur is a neighborhood characterized by its green, woodsy atmosphere, with clusters of oak and maple trees providing shade and seasonal color. The area features mid-century ranch-style homes and bungalows from the 1950s and 60s, typically situated on quarter-acre plots with garages and single-car driveways. North Lake Park, located on the east coast of Lake Decatur, offers 24 acres of wooded land with picturesque trails and an archery club. The Children’s Museum of Illinois, located 3 miles west in Scovill Park, provides interactive exhibits and educational programs for children. Dining options include Everyone’s East End Grill, known for its comfort food and family-friendly atmosphere, and the New Moon Café, which offers a mix of American diner staples and Mexican favorites along with live entertainment. The Devon Lakeshore Amphitheater hosts concerts and a summer movie series. For shopping, a busy retail corridor with stores like Kroger and Walmart Supercenter is less than 3 miles south of Decatur Airport. Illinois Route 105 provides a direct route into downtown Decatur, 5 miles west. Public transportation is available via the Decatur Public Transit System, though sidewalks are rare, making a car necessary for most errands. Schools in the area include Michael Baum Elementary, Stephen Decatur Middle School, and Eisenhower High School, which offers a program for students to earn an Associate’s Degree alongside their high school diploma.
